Hariri accuses Syria’s Assad of being ‘terrorist’

Former Prime Minister Saad Hariri responded Thursday to the ​remarks made by Syrian President Bashar al-Assad who considered that “stamping out terrorism requires a joint international effort.”

 

“Assad speaks of terrorism and he is the terrorist par excellence,” Hariri said via his Twitter account.

Earlier today, Assad received US Senator Richard Black and discussed with him the situation in Syria.

During the discussion, the president highlighted that the terrorist attacks, which have hit several areas in the world, prove that terrorism knows no borders.

Fighting terrorism, he added, demands a joint international effort.
